2015-08-07 2 views
0

У меня возникли трудности с получением более чем одного значения графика перфтата для отображения с использованием pnp4nagios с naemon. Похоже, что формат не тот, который Nagios ожидает передать pnp4nagios. Я думаю, что у меня самая последняя версия check_int.pl: программы: check_netint.pl или check_snmp_netint.pl Версия: 2,4 альфа 9 Дата: 30 Ноя, 2012pnp4nagios отображает только первый граф, возвращенный check_int.pl

perfdata формат выглядит нормально. В других, которые работают с несколькими графиками, похоже, есть эквивалентное количество записей в левой части «|», как правая сторона. Я также попытался ввести значения -w и -c, так что ;;; ниже заполнены эти. Кажется, это не имеет значения.

Я хотел бы получить 4 графика из приведенных ниже данных возврата, в/из для каждого из двух интерфейсов. Любые идеи?

% /usr/lib64/naemon/plugins//check_int.pl -H 10.61.146.227 -C sparkred -2 -n bond0 -w -z -f -e -S -k -Y -B 


bond0:UP (1717.9Kbps/3854.1Kbps), bond0.1422:UP (19.0Kbps/326.0Kbps) (2 UP): OK | 'bond0_in_bps'=1717881;;; 'bond0_out_bps'=3854092;;; 'bond0.1422_in_bps'=19023;;; 'bond0.1422_out_bps'=325999;;; 

Спасибо!

ответ

0

Я думаю, что вам не хватает на pnp4nagiosшаблон, написанные специально для этого конкретного плагина Nagios.

Try загрузки: https://raw.githubusercontent.com/willixix/WL-NagiosPlugins/master/graphing_templates/pnp4nagios/check_snmp_network_interface_linux.php

и поместить его в ваших pnp4nagios шаблоны папки. На моей системе, этот путь заканчивается существо:

/usr/local/pnp4nagios/share/templates/check_snmp_network_interface_linux.php 

Затем перезапустить службу Nagios.

Вот больше информации о pnp4nagios шаблонах: http://docs.pnp4nagios.org/pnp-0.6/tpl

Это сайт автора плагина Nagios в: http://william.leibzon.org/nagios/

Смежные вопросы